What is it?
A 12-week class that will help you improve your reading and writing skills in English, AND learn about jobs in the health care industry.
There will be 2 teachers – Health Care and English as a Second Language.
This class will help you learn more about health care careers. You will have:
- visits from health-care professionals
- career counseling
- educational counseling from Austin Community College counselors
- financial aid information
- free college entrance testing (TCOM)
